We are looking for a Physical Therapist (PT) for an immediate travel opening in York, PA. The right PT should have 1 year of experience; for an exceptional candidate with an appropriate background, 6 months of experience may be accepted. Read below for additional requirements.
As a PT, you will be responsible for the evaluation, development, and execution of a plan of care for a variety of patient populations in the acute care setting.
Must have 6 months of experience; however, new grads are encouraged to apply. Must have BLS and state-specific licensing.
Physical Therapists should be able to stand and walk for long periods of time, as well as bend, lean or stoop without difficulty. PTs must have a sound knowledge of anatomy, physiology, pathology and medical terminology.
